Item 5 FULL DESCRIPTION OF MATERIAL CHANGE
Medallion Resources is pleased to report that the initial drill program on the Zoquite high grade silver project near Zacatecas, Mexico is to commence January 8, 1999. This program will test several very significant silver, gold and base metal anomalies associated with the eastern extension of the Cantera Vein, one of three major vein systems in the Zacatecas district.
More than one billion ounces of silver and four million ounces of gold have been produced from the Zacatecas camp. The Cantera Vein has produced about one-third of this total from several mines to the west of the Medallion property.
This initial 1500-meter drill program is designed to test the vein at depth within the area most favorable for metal deposition. No previous exploration ever tested the seven-kilometer extension of the Cantera Vein exposed on the Medallion property at the depths planned in this program, yet intercepts as high as 84 g/t silver and 0.5 g/t gold over 5.5 meters were encountered in shallow drilling. Typical ore grades in the district exceeded 300 g/t silver with significant gold and base metals.
This initial program is scheduled to be completed by the end of January. Results will be announced as soon as they can be compiled and verified. If strong ore-grade intercepts are achieved, the company plans to extend the initial program with offsets of the most encouraging intercepts.
